I have a new JVC GZ-HD7 camcorder that makes a 1920x1080i .mpg file with mpeg audio. I would like to convert these to the hr.hdtv (960x540). My current media player will handle this fine. I look to upgrade to a media player that will handle h.264 someday. Haven't been able to find much on this subject and am hoping someone here can shed some light on this for me.

Lots of us are waiting for such players. I had some hope that a DLink player that is out now might be the answer I was looking for. It can play H.264 and HD video, but then I found out that any bitrates over 6000 Kbps are too much for it to play smoothly, so that's a no go for me. I archive a few things from HD TV captures in MPEG-2 at bitrates over 11000 and a player that can't handle them is useless to me. My advice would be to keep waiting.Originally Posted by MrFingers
